Yahoo! Mail Announces Photomail Beta, Providing An Easier Way
To Share Photos By E-Mail
Additional Yahoo! Mail Updates Include Availability of More
Languages, Integrated Top News Feed, and DomainKeys Indicator
Sunnyvale, CA -- Yahoo! Inc., (Nasdaq:YHOO - News) announced last
month the beta release of an innovative e-mail photo sharing
feature called PhotoMail, available for free from Yahoo! Mail
(http://mail.yahoo.com), a global leader in e-mail and the No. 1
e-mail service in the United States. PhotoMail greatly simplifies
the e-mail photo sharing experience by allowing people to insert up
to 300 photos into the body of an e-mail, minimizing the worry of
exceeding message or attachment size limits. The new PhotoMail
feature tightly integrates Yahoo! Mail with both Yahoo! Photos and
Yahoo! Image Search.
Yahoo! Mail is also adding six additional languages and new
localized sites to make the service available in more languages
than any other Web-based e-mail provider, a new customizable "In
the News" feature to the welcome page for its U.S. users, and an
extension to its DomainKeys e-mail authentication technology to
increase consumer protection from spam, e-mail forgery, and
phishing scams.

Lenovo * Even more languages -- Beginning in June, Yahoo! Mail will be
available in more languages than any other Web-based e-mail
provider. As part of Yahoo!'s commitment to reaching more users in
more countries, Yahoo! Mail has added a total of six additional
languages and seven new localized sites in Eastern Europe and
Southeast Asia: Poland, Turkey, Thailand, Malaysia, Vietnam,
Philippines, and Indonesia. With this expansion, Yahoo! Mail will
be available on 34 localized sites worldwide and offered in 21
languages.

Travelstar * Fighting e-mail forgery and the phishing scams -- As part of
Yahoo! Mail's ongoing goal to provide users with the safest Webmail
experience possible, DomainKeys e-mail authentication technology
has been implemented to increase consumer protection from spam,
e-mail forgery, and phishing scams. Effective now, Yahoo! Mail has
added a tag under the "From" line of e-mail messages based on
DomainKeys technology, providing additional information to
consumers about the origin of e-mails they receive. The DomainKeys
Indicator confirms whether or not the e-mail really does, in fact,
come from the expected domain listed in the "From" line. More
information on DomainKeys is available at
http://antispam.yahoo.com/domainkeys.
